9. (TCO E, F) Neff Incorporated is a small business with 100 employees and 4 managers.

Susan and Bob work are co-workers at Neff Incorporated. Ever since they were both assigned to work on Project X, they have been arguing about how to meet the goals of that project.

On Monday they get into a very loud argument about Project X, in the cafeteria during lunch break. Manager 1 is told about the argument and he sends out an email which says: “Greetings everyone. I heard that there may have been a small disagreement in the cafeteria at lunchtime. I just want you all to know that I appreciate the good work you are all doing on Project X. I know that everyone here really gets along even though a little workplace stress can sometimes build up. It is good that we have such a warm, friendly group of employees working here at Neff Incorporated”.

On Tuesday, Susan and Bob get into another argument about Project X at lunchtime. Manager 2 decides that she will deal with the situation this time. She sends them an email stating: “Susan and Bob, you have both worked here at Neff for 5 years and you have worked on many projects together. I know you are both passionate about our mission and goals here at Neff. I also know that you sometimes disagree with each other on how to meet those goals, but we need to look at the big picture. You are both on the same team and both working towards the same goals. Please do not let small disagreements get in the way of this.”

On Wednesday, Susan and Bob get into a third argument about Project X, in the cafeteria again. Manager 3 decides he is going to handle the situation this time. He sends them an email stating, “Susan and Bob, if you cannot get along and maintain professionalism here at Neff Incorporated, I will have no choice but to terminate you both. Consider this your written warning. These loud arguments in public must stop now”.

On Thursday, Susan finds that a small cup of water has spilled on her desk. She thinks it may have been Bob who did it but she is not sure. She quietly tells Manager 4 about the situation. Manager 4 asks Susan and Bob to come into her office. She says, “Ok, I understand that on Monday, Tuesday and Wednesday of this week you two had loud arguments in the cafeteria about Project X. Let’s talk this through in an orderly and respectful fashion. I’m handing you both a sheet of paper. Please list your disagreements about the Project and we will deal with them one by one. Let’s get this resolved today.”
